Researchers say nanorockets could deliver medicine quickly within the blood

Faster delivery is always better when it comes to pizza, Thai food and now... drugs? Doctors seem to think so as they're experimenting with a new method of delivering medicine to the bloodstream via tiny nanotubes powered by rocket fuel. By storing healing meds within the platinum-coated metal tubes, doctors have been able to propel the tiny vessels up to 200 times their own length per second -- faster than swimming bacteria. It works as such: by introducing a hydrogen peroxide/water solution, the platinum reacts, sending it zipping forward and catalyzing the peroxide into water and oxygen. The downside? Even though the fuel is only .25 percent peroxide, it's still slightly toxic -- so it looks like it's back to the drawing board until they can develop a safer alternative. Spiders, perhaps?
